WynnBet Gets Ohio Access

This story was published more than 3 years ago.

American interactive betting operator WynnBet (the software branch of Wynn Resorts) has announced that they've secured a partner to offer services in Ohio when the market eventually launches.

WynnBet currently has operations in New Jersey, Colorado, and will be launching in Michigan today at noon. The company also has signed deals with casinos in the following states to launch in the future: Nevada, Iowa, Massachusetts, and Indiana. Ohio will be the eighth state that WynnBet is planning to launch in, with the potential of sportsbetting and casino games being offered if the state authorizes them through the legislature.

The company didn't announce who they're partnered with, and there's no indication from politicians in the state as to when online services may be available.
